About L G ALARCON EL

L G ALARCON EL is a cozy elementary-level community in SAN ELIZARIO, Texas, overseen by SAN ELIZARIO ISD. The school enrolls 297 students in grades 3 through 6. Compared to the state average of about 519 students per school, that is 43% below typical.

Within SAN ELIZARIO ISD, which oversees 6 schools and 2,927 students, L G ALARCON EL is one campus in the system.

In terms of who attends, L G ALARCON EL shows that 99% of students identify as Hispanic, making the school strongly Hispanic-majority. That is visibly more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 83%.

In terms of school funding signals, L G ALARCON EL reports 18 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 16.6:1. The state averages around 15.1: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. Around 87%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. By comparison, El Paso County runs at roughly 74%, so the school's eligibility rate is meaningfully above the surrounding baseline.

After controlling for student poverty, L G ALARCON EL s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 35.8%; this one delivers 32.7%.

In the surrounding community, ACS estimates for El Paso County put median household earnings sit near $59,806, 26%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 16%. L G ALARCON EL is one of 273 public schools in El Paso County (combined enrollment of about 165,404 students).

ANN M GARCIA-ENRIQUEZ MIDDLE is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.3 miles from this campus.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. Among the 7 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), L G ALARCON EL ranks 5th on composite proficiency, beneath the local average of 42.6%.

L G ALARCON EL operates from a bedroom-community location.

Looking at the recent track record.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at L G ALARCON EL has ticked down 53%, going from 628 students in 2018 to 297 in 2025.
